The integration of AI driver cameras in trucks has paved the way for a new era of fleet management where data-driven insights play a crucial role in decision-making processes. These cameras are strategically placed inside the cab of the truck to capture footage of the driver’s behavior, road conditions, and surrounding environment. By leveraging AI algorithms, these cameras can analyze the footage in real-time to detect risky driving behavior such as distracted driving, speeding, harsh braking, and lane departures.
One of the key benefits of AI driver cameras is their ability to provide real-time feedback to drivers, helping them improve their behavior on the road. By alerting drivers to unsafe practices immediately, these cameras enable drivers to make timely corrections and reduce the risk of accidents. Moreover, AI driver cameras also play a vital role in exonerating drivers in case of accidents by providing irrefutable evidence of the events leading up to the incident.
From a fleet management perspective, AI driver cameras offer valuable insights into driver performance, fuel efficiency, and vehicle maintenance. By monitoring driver behavior and identifying areas for improvement, fleet managers can implement targeted training programs to enhance driver safety and performance. Additionally, AI driver cameras can track vehicle performance metrics such as fuel consumption, engine health, and maintenance needs, enabling fleet managers to schedule preventive maintenance and reduce downtime.
Furthermore, AI driver cameras also play a pivotal role in improving compliance with industry regulations and standards. By capturing and analyzing driver behavior, these cameras ensure that drivers adhere to safety protocols, hours-of-service regulations, and traffic laws. This not only helps fleets avoid costly fines and penalties but also fosters a culture of safety and compliance within the organization.

Despite the numerous benefits of AI driver cameras, some concerns have been raised regarding privacy and data security. As these cameras continuously monitor and record driver behavior, there is a risk of infringing on drivers’ privacy rights. To address these concerns, fleet operators must ensure transparency and accountability in the use of AI driver cameras, including obtaining consent from drivers, implementing strict data protection measures, and establishing clear policies regarding the use and storage of footage.
